Output fdac36f3a60bd2ec8160ffcd2064b00396b56a61385e0fc78514471734b5db09:0

value
12820
script pubkey
OP_0 OP_PUSHBYTES_20 39aee58ae05e366c7226dc4057c13a37246d94b0
address
bc1q8xhwtzhqtcmxcu3xm3q90sf6xujxm99s4ggkxa
transaction
fdac36f3a60bd2ec8160ffcd2064b00396b56a61385e0fc78514471734b5db09
confirmations
317600
spent
true